14. Which is a sentence fragment? Watching a scary film with my friends at the theater. It’s overdue. If you do not understand,

ask your teacher for help. Call me.
English
1 answer:
NemiM [27]3 years ago
6 0
A sentence fragment is a part of a sentence - it cannot exist on its own, but rather has to be included within a larger sentence in order to make sense. Having this in mind, the correct answer is Watching a scary film with my friends at the theater.
This fragment doesn't have a verb at all, which is why it is a fragment rather than a clause, like the other options.

At which of the following schools would a student acquire an associate's degree?
qwelly [4]
The best answer here is Dade County Junior College. The reason for this is that an associate's degree is the degree that comes before a bachelor's degree. This degree generally takes two years to complete and allows the bearer to attend a university and move straight into their degree program. The other options are all university's, which means they all will offer bachelor's degrees instead of associate's.
